Subject: [PATCH v4 09/29] drivers: core: Use fw_devlink_set_device()
Date: Wed, 15 Oct 2025 09:13:56 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20251015071420.1173068-10-herve.codina@bootlin.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20251015071420.1173068-1-herve.codina@bootlin.com>
The code set directly fwnode->dev field.
Use the dedicated fw_devlink_set_device() helper to perform this
operation.
Signed-off-by: Herve Codina <herve.codina@bootlin.com>
Reviewed-by: Andy Shevchenko <and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com>
---
 drivers/base/core.c | 4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/base/core.c b/drivers/base/core.c
index 3e81b1914ce5..9da630d75d17 100644
--- a/drivers/base/core.c
+++ b/drivers/base/core.c
@@ -3739,7 +3739,7 @@ int device_add(struct device *dev)
 	 * device and the driver sync_state callback is called for this device.
 	 */
 	if (dev->fwnode && !dev->fwnode->dev) {
-		dev->fwnode->dev = dev;
+		fw_devlink_set_device(dev->fwnode, dev);
 		fw_devlink_link_device(dev);
 	}
 
@@ -3899,7 +3899,7 @@ void device_del(struct device *dev)
 	device_unlock(dev);
 
 	if (dev->fwnode && dev->fwnode->dev == dev)
-		dev->fwnode->dev = NULL;
+		fw_devlink_set_device(dev->fwnode, NULL);
 
 	/* Notify clients of device removal.  This call must come
 	 * before dpm_sysfs_remove().
